Whoopi Goldberg has been the moderator on The View for nearly twenty years. She joined the show after Rosie O’Donnell’s departure in 2007. Whoopi reportedly signed a four-year deal in 2021. She returned for Season 29 but whether she’s under a new contract wasn’t made clear.
Some fans think her time on the show should end. Viewers took aim at her, demanding she be ousted from the show for her shocking behavior.
Whoopi Goldberg Drops F-Bomb On Live TV
Whoopi Goldberg is passionate about her beliefs, especially her political ideology. The current hosts of The View come from various political affiliations, but many lean left. One of the biggest complaints from viewers is the lack of equal airtime for conservative voices. But a guest next week is a huge step in remedying that.

Marjorie Taylor Greene, the Representative of the 14th Congressional District in Georgia, is a guest on Tuesday, November 4. Her appearance falls on Election Day. Whoopi Goldberg got heated when promoting MTG’s appearance on Thursday’s show. The View co-host touted the lawmaker’s recent comments speaking out against the government shutdown.
Whoopi Goldberg was surprised that she agreed with the congresswoman on the issue. The actress blasted the Senate and said the shutdown “should not be affecting the American people.” In a moment that shocked her co-stars and the audience, Whoopi Goldberg almost cursed on live TV when she said, “These are decisions that you don’t have the right to…” She seemed poised to drop the f-bomb but stopped herself.

After a commercial break, she told the audience that a viewer had called in to complain about the near slip-up.
